In the world of enterprise AI, especially within Retrieval-Augmented Generation (RAG) systems, there's a shift from blind trust to deterministic observability. While RAG systems promise to revolutionize customer support, data retrieval, and information processing, they also harbor hidden challenges. Without appropriate visibility, these systems can silently fail, posing significant risks to businesses, particularly those in regulated industries.
Understanding the Challenges
Many enterprise RAG systems suffer from "retrieval drift," a gradual degradation of response quality that can go unnoticed until it becomes a critical issue. Unlike overt system failures, this drift doesn't trigger immediate alarms. The system continues to operate, yet the accuracy of its responses declines, potentially leading to the citation of incorrect sources or outdated information.
Traditional monitoring tools focus on metrics like latency and error rates, which, while useful, don't capture the nuances of RAG systems. These systems require specialized telemetry to track retrieval precision, source relevance, and answer faithfulness. Without this data, organizations are essentially flying blind, unaware of the deteriorating accuracy of their systems.
Strategy 1: Multi-Layer Retrieval Confidence Scoring
The first step in achieving deterministic observability is implementing robust confidence scoring for retrievals. This involves evaluating documents across multiple dimensions such as semantic similarity, contextual relevance, and temporal freshness. By scoring retrieval attempts and setting confidence thresholds, organizations can ensure that only relevant and current information is passed on for response generation.
Strategy 2: Granular Telemetry Across Pipeline Stages
Instrumentation across every stage of the RAG pipeline is crucial for comprehensive observability. Each component, from query understanding to answer generation, should emit structured logs and metrics. This allows teams to trace a query's journey and identify where issues may arise.
Structured logging, with consistent schemas, enables powerful analytics and faster issue resolution. By linking all logs for a single query with a unique identifier, teams can quickly pinpoint where a breakdown occurred.
Strategy 3: Establishing Audit Trails for Compliance
For industries bound by stringent regulations, having audit trails is non-negotiable. Every query and its corresponding answer must have a complete record showing which documents were considered and why they were selected. Implementing version-controlled retrieval ensures that all changes in documents, embedding models, and pipeline configurations are tracked, providing a reproducible and verifiable audit trail.
Strategy 4: Self-Healing Loops with Automated Drift Detection
To prevent retrieval drift from impacting user experience, self-healing systems that automatically detect and correct degradations are vital. Key metrics such as confidence score distribution, retrieval precision, and user feedback signals should be monitored for signs of drift. When detected, automated correction mechanisms can refresh embedding models, recalibrate confidence thresholds, and review document corpora.
Strategy 5: Context Budgeting with Smart Compression
Efficient use of context windows is another aspect of observability. Context budgeting assigns token budgets to different query types, applying compression strategies when budgets are exceeded. Techniques such as extractive summarization and entity-focused filtering help maintain quality while reducing token consumption.
Strategy 6: Building Comprehensive Retrieval Dashboards
Visualizing telemetry data through dashboards provides real-time insights into system health and performance. Essential views include system health overviews, retrieval performance metrics, cost analytics, and compliance monitoring. Intelligent alerting rules ensure that deviations from expected performance are promptly addressed.
Strategy 7: Continuous Evaluation Frameworks
Observability is an ongoing effort. Continuous evaluation frameworks automatically test systems against benchmarks and real user queries, ensuring that quality remains high as data and usage patterns evolve. Regular evaluations against industry standards and internal gold standards help maintain system reliability and effectiveness.
Transitioning from a black box approach to a transparent, observable system is not just about improving accuracy; it's about building trust, ensuring compliance, and optimizing performance. The seven strategies outlined—confidence scoring, granular telemetry, audit trails, self-healing loops, context budgeting, comprehensive dashboards, and continuous evaluation—form a comprehensive framework for deterministic observability in RAG systems.
By implementing these strategies, organizations can preemptively address issues, maintain compliance, reduce costs, and foster innovation, ultimately transforming their RAG systems into adaptable and reliable components of their enterprise IT infrastructure. The journey toward full observability begins with incremental steps, each contributing to a more transparent and trustworthy AI deployment.
